Creating a World of Elegance: The Vision Behind the Shoot
This shoot was an exercise in intentional elegance. From the vintage-inspired gowns curated by Revelle Bridal and the couture suits by Third Son Tailor Shop to the lush florals by Wedecor Inc, every element was chosen for its ability to reflect the grandeur and sophistication of Old Hollywood while keeping a modern sensibility. The warm tones of deep espresso, golden champagne, and mocha mousse, complemented by delicate pearls and silk, set a refined yet intimate atmosphere throughout the day.
The shoot’s goal was clear: to craft a wedding that wasn’t just visually stunning, but emotionally resonant. It was about more than just the decor or the gowns; it was about telling a love story. The layers of silk, gauze, and lace worked together seamlessly, creating an atmosphere that was both vintage and modern in its beauty.
